Parkleys is Grade II listed by English Heritage for its architectural interest as the first major Span development by architect Eric Lyons (President of the Royal Institute of British Architects (RIBA) 1975-1977). He worked under Walter Gropius (founder of the Bauhaus) and became noted for progressive developments with signature attention to landscape and community, with a blend of modernism with more traditional elements like tile hanging and stock brick. Beginning with Parkleys in 1955-6, his practice collected many awards and even as recently as 2005, Span received a special Housing Design Award given to schemes that meet the current Sustainable Communities Plan.
